  • A security evaluation resulted in the closure of nearly half of important tourist destinations in Kashmir.
    Posted on May 1st, 2025 in Exam Details (QP Included)

    • Over half of Kashmir’s major tourist sites have been closed due to a security audit.

    • Of the 89 tourist destinations audited, 49 have been closed to tourists.

    • Only destinations with multi-tier security cover are allowed to host tourists.

    • The closures are a short-term measure and will be lifted once areas are declared secure.

    • In north Kashmir, Gurez, Bangus valley, Baba Reshi, and Kaman Post are closed.

    • In Srinagar, 16 sites have been identified as no-go areas for tourists.

    • In central Kashmir, Naranag, Yousmarg, Toisamaidan, Aharbal, and Kousarenag are closed.

    • In south Kashmir, Sun Temple at Kehribal, Verinag, Sinthan Top, and Margan Top have also been closed
